Subject: Cut-over complete — Brackenlight audit-log viewer

Hi support team,

The cut-over to the new Brackenlight audit-log viewer finished last night without data loss. Legacy links redirect automatically, but retention filters now default to 90 days, so users reporting "missing" entries should widen the date range first. Exports over 50k rows queue asynchronously. If you need to verify behavior against the live deployment, the settings it is currently running with are listed below.

service settings:
PRAWYN_PIN=9848
PRAWYN_METRICS_HOST=metrics.prawyn.lumicworks.corp
PRAWYN_LOG_LEVEL=warn
PRAWYN_TENANT=pelius

// Relevance tuning constants for the Marrowfield search tier.
// These weights were recalibrated after the Q3 recall regression:
// title-match boost dropped from 2.4 to 1.9, and freshness decay
// now uses a 14-day half-life instead of 30. If on-call sees
// ranking complaints, check the Dunlevy synonym cache before
// touching these values — stale synonyms mimic weight drift.
// The calibration run that produced these numbers is traceable
// via the token below.

session token of bawep-yadup = htk21_528abd376e3c5a4ec24a1

Document Transport — Print Shop Master Copies

Quick guide for moving master copies to Bramblehurst Print Co. These are the only originals, so treat the run like a valuables transfer, not a regular parcel drop. Use the red tamper-evident envelopes from the supply shelf, log the seal number in the transport book, and never combine the run with general mail. The masters go directly to the press supervisor, nobody else. On arrival, the courier must follow the hand-over instruction stated below.

drop instructions, kajep-tageg: the kasvan casdor courier leaves the quenvan quenox druox ledger at gate 4316 under passcode 799004